Originally published in 1847, this classic work by Charlotte Brontë revolutionized the art of fiction with its exploration of "the private consciousness" which included sexuality, religion, and classism. The novel follows Jane Eyre, and her emotions and experiences, as she grows to adulthood and falls in love with Mr. Rochester.
